Analysis

The most recent figure for overcrowding rate by age, sex and group of citizenship in United Kingdom is 14.8%, measured in 2018.

The figure is up 5.7% on the previous year and down 58.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, overcrowding rate by age, sex and group of citizenship in United Kingdom peaked at 45.7%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 14.0%, in 2017.

That places United Kingdom 18th out of 22 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.

Overcrowding rate by age, sex and group of citizenship in United Kingdom, year by year

Annual values for Overcrowding rate by age, sex and group of citizenship (total population aged 18 and over) in United Kingdom, 2009 to 2018.
Year Percentage Change
2009 35.8%
2010 45.7% +27.7%
2011 28.9% -36.8%
2012 18.5% -36.0%
2013 17.6% -4.9%
2014 29.1% +65.3%
2015 34.1% +17.2%
2016 24.6% -27.9%
2017 14.0% -43.1%
2018 14.8% +5.7%
